433
This section allows you to view all posts made by this member. Note that you can only see posts made in areas you currently have access to.
434
ห้อง MS Access / : สอบถามการทำแจ้งเตือนใน Access
« เมื่อ: 24 มี.ค. 62 , 09:54:08 »
ใช่ครับ เป็นวิธีในฟอร์ม
435
ห้อง MS Access / : cannot open any more tables
« เมื่อ: 24 มี.ค. 62 , 09:09:01 »
ไม่เยอะนะครับ
เท่าที่นึกได้ ถ้าไม่ใช่ไฟล์ที่คุณสร้างเอง อาจมีการฝัง Module ให้ทำไม่ได้ก็เป็นได้
หรือไม่ Access อาจหมดอายุ ถ้าเป็นแถบสีแดงด้านบนก็ใช่เลยครับ หมดอายุ
เท่าที่นึกได้ ถ้าไม่ใช่ไฟล์ที่คุณสร้างเอง อาจมีการฝัง Module ให้ทำไม่ได้ก็เป็นได้
หรือไม่ Access อาจหมดอายุ ถ้าเป็นแถบสีแดงด้านบนก็ใช่เลยครับ หมดอายุ
436
ห้อง MS Access / : สอบถามการทำแจ้งเตือนใน Access
« เมื่อ: 24 มี.ค. 62 , 09:06:22 »
ใช้การกำหนด Conditional Formatting ครับ
437
ห้อง MS Access / : cannot open any more tables
« เมื่อ: 23 มี.ค. 62 , 14:01:54 »
ได้เช็คขนาดไฟล์ดูหรือไม่ครับ บางทีไฟล์อาจใหญ่มากก็ได้
438
ห้อง MS Access / : อยาก สร้าง Report เปรียบเทียบ ราคารวมของแต่ละเดือน
« เมื่อ: 22 มี.ค. 62 , 21:47:30 »
ใช้ Crosstab Query ครับ
439
ห้อง MS Access / : Popup ข้อความ
« เมื่อ: 18 มี.ค. 62 , 17:37:53 »
กำหนด Properties ของ Text Box เป็น Can Growth = Yes ก็จะแสดงทั้งหมดได้
440
ห้อง MS Access / : นำแบบสอบถาม ที่สร้างไว้ไปทำ รายงานไม่ได้ขึ้น out of stack space จะแก้ไขอย่างไร
« เมื่อ: 02 มี.ค. 62 , 11:11:17 »
ลองส่งไฟล์มาให้ดูดีกว่าไหมครับ
441
ห้อง MS Access / : อักขระที่มองไม่เห็น
« เมื่อ: 02 มี.ค. 62 , 11:10:26 »
ปกติเวลาเกิดปัญหา มันจะมี Error Message แจ้งขึ้นมา บอกว่าปัญหาเกิดจากอะไร
แล้วมันจะมีตารางที่สร้างขึ้นมาใหม่ 1 ตารางให้ 1 ตาราง ถ้าลองดูฟิลด์ที่มีปัญหา น่าจะได้คำตอบครับ
แล้วมันจะมีตารางที่สร้างขึ้นมาใหม่ 1 ตารางให้ 1 ตาราง ถ้าลองดูฟิลด์ที่มีปัญหา น่าจะได้คำตอบครับ
442
ห้อง MS Access / : เซฟเรคคอร์ดแล้วทำการรีคิวรี่ฟอร์มย่อย
« เมื่อ: 26 ก.พ. 62 , 21:45:45 »
ไฟล์ที่คุณส่งมา ผมเปิดแล้วติด Error ตั้งแต่ตอนเปิดฟอร์ม SFPOPL เลยครับ
ผมไม่อยากไล่ Code นะครับ ก็เลยใช้การวิเคราะห์เอาจากรูปที่คุณแจ้งไว้ในตอนแรก แล้วดูเฉพาะ Code ส่วนที่เกี่ยวข้อง
1. จาก Error แจ้งว่าต้องป้อนข้อมูลเข้าไปในฟิลด์ IdPL ของตาราง TbPL แสดงว่าไม่มีการป้อนข้อมูลเข้าฟิลด์นี้ ถึงได้เกิดปัญหา
2. พอไปเช็คใน Form_Load ของฟอร์มนี้ ก็สะดุดที่
Me.txtIdPL = strThmbFind + "0"
3. ปัญหาคือ ผมหา strThmbFind ไม่เจอว่าอยู่ที่ไหน เห็นแต่กำหนดเป็น Public ไว้ที่ Module1
ปัญหาน่าจะมาจากตรงนี้นะครับ
ผมไม่อยากไล่ Code นะครับ ก็เลยใช้การวิเคราะห์เอาจากรูปที่คุณแจ้งไว้ในตอนแรก แล้วดูเฉพาะ Code ส่วนที่เกี่ยวข้อง
1. จาก Error แจ้งว่าต้องป้อนข้อมูลเข้าไปในฟิลด์ IdPL ของตาราง TbPL แสดงว่าไม่มีการป้อนข้อมูลเข้าฟิลด์นี้ ถึงได้เกิดปัญหา
2. พอไปเช็คใน Form_Load ของฟอร์มนี้ ก็สะดุดที่
Me.txtIdPL = strThmbFind + "0"
3. ปัญหาคือ ผมหา strThmbFind ไม่เจอว่าอยู่ที่ไหน เห็นแต่กำหนดเป็น Public ไว้ที่ Module1
ปัญหาน่าจะมาจากตรงนี้นะครับ
443
ห้อง MS Access / : Data ใน ตารางหาย ช่วยขอวิธีแก้ด้วยครับ
« เมื่อ: 25 ก.พ. 62 , 20:01:16 »
แปะภาพให้ดู แล้วส่งไฟล์มาดีกว่าครับ แบบนี้ไม่เข้าใจ
444
ห้อง MS Access / : สอบถามการสร้าง Report ให้ออกมาตาม Order No.
« เมื่อ: 24 ก.พ. 62 , 08:30:23 »
ส่งไฟล์มาให้คนแถวยี้ดูหน่อยได้ไหมครับ (ข้อมูลตัวอย่างก็พอ)
445
ห้อง MS Access / : จะสั่งปริ้นท์จากรหัสสินค้าโดยนับจำนวนสินค้ายังไงคะ
« เมื่อ: 08 ก.พ. 62 , 09:54:11 »
ใส่ฟิลด์ลำดับสินค้าเข้าไปในสิ่งที่จะพิมพ์ด้วยครับ และแนะนำว่าใช้คำสั่ง Label เพื่อสร้างสติ๊กเกอร์ครับ
446
ห้อง MS Access / : นำค่าใน textbox 2 ต่อกัน แต่ถูกตัดเลข0นำหน้าออก แก้อย่างไรครับ
« เมื่อ: 25 ม.ค. 62 , 22:41:31 »
ลอง
text3= textbox1 & CStr(textbox2)
text3= textbox1 & CStr(textbox2)
447
ห้อง MS Access / : ส่งออก Text File 19 Column แต่ Import กลับมา เป็น 12 Column
« เมื่อ: 22 ม.ค. 62 , 12:42:48 »
Line Feed มาจาก Co_unitdrug ครับ เข้าไปแก้ที่นี่ครับ ง่ายกว่าเยอะ
448
ห้อง MS Access / : ส่งออก Text File 19 Column แต่ Import กลับมา เป็น 12 Column
« เมื่อ: 22 ม.ค. 62 , 12:17:57 »
ที่ฟิลด์นี้มี Line Feed ซ่อนอยู่ครับ ลองเปิดอยู่ที่ Text File แล้วกดลูกศรขวาไล่ไปทีละตัวอักษรดู
หลังคำว่า เม็ด ขวด จะกดแล้วไม่ไปไหน 1 เคาะ
(แก้ไข 1) ปล. ไม่แน่ใจว่าเป็น Line Feed หรือ Zero Space นะครับ หาเอง
(แก้ไข 2) มันคือ Line Feed
หลังคำว่า เม็ด ขวด จะกดแล้วไม่ไปไหน 1 เคาะ
(แก้ไข 1) ปล. ไม่แน่ใจว่าเป็น Line Feed หรือ Zero Space นะครับ หาเอง
(แก้ไข 2) มันคือ Line Feed
449
ห้อง MS Access / : ส่งออก Text File 19 Column แต่ Import กลับมา เป็น 12 Column
« เมื่อ: 22 ม.ค. 62 , 12:07:00 »
จะตอบไงดี
เกี่ยวแน่นอนครับ
คือผมทดสอบแล้ว ครั้งล่าสุด หลังจากพบว่าคุณกำหนดเป็น None ตอน Export เลยสามารถทำให้เกิดปัญหาแบบเดียวกับที่คุณเจอได้แล้ว
และการทดสอบก่อนหน้า ตอน Export ใช้ "" แต่ตอน Import ก็ใช้ "" ก็ทำได้อย่างไม่มีปัญหา ข้อมูลมาครบไม่ขึ้นเรคอร์ดใหม่
ลองดูครับ
เกี่ยวแน่นอนครับ
คือผมทดสอบแล้ว ครั้งล่าสุด หลังจากพบว่าคุณกำหนดเป็น None ตอน Export เลยสามารถทำให้เกิดปัญหาแบบเดียวกับที่คุณเจอได้แล้ว
และการทดสอบก่อนหน้า ตอน Export ใช้ "" แต่ตอน Import ก็ใช้ "" ก็ทำได้อย่างไม่มีปัญหา ข้อมูลมาครบไม่ขึ้นเรคอร์ดใหม่
ลองดูครับ
450
ห้อง MS Access / : ส่งออก Text File 19 Column แต่ Import กลับมา เป็น 12 Column
« เมื่อ: 22 ม.ค. 62 , 11:42:02 »
ผมเข้าใจแล้ว ว่าเกิดอะไรขึ้น
เนื่องจากตารางของคุณมีฟิลด์ว่างอยู่ การ Export โดยไม่ใช้ "" เป็นตัวกำหนดฟิลด์ ทำให้เกิดปัญหาในการ Export-Import ระหว่าง Text File
ต้องไม่ลืมนะครับว่า Text File เป็นการจัดเรียงข้อมูลโดยไม่มีขอบเขต แต่ Excel และ Access มีการใช้ขอบเขตข้อมูล
ดังนั้นการส่งข้อมูลจาก Text File โดยไม่ใด้ใช้การกำหนดขอบเขตข้อมูลมาตรฐาน (คือไม่ได้ใช้ "" แต่ใช้ตัว |) จึงไม่แปลกที่จะเกิดปัญหานี้
ข้อแนะนำคือเปลี่ยนมาใช้ตัว "" หรือ ; หรือ , หรือ Tab แทนการใช้ตัว | จะดีกว่า
เนื่องจากตารางของคุณมีฟิลด์ว่างอยู่ การ Export โดยไม่ใช้ "" เป็นตัวกำหนดฟิลด์ ทำให้เกิดปัญหาในการ Export-Import ระหว่าง Text File
ต้องไม่ลืมนะครับว่า Text File เป็นการจัดเรียงข้อมูลโดยไม่มีขอบเขต แต่ Excel และ Access มีการใช้ขอบเขตข้อมูล
ดังนั้นการส่งข้อมูลจาก Text File โดยไม่ใด้ใช้การกำหนดขอบเขตข้อมูลมาตรฐาน (คือไม่ได้ใช้ "" แต่ใช้ตัว |) จึงไม่แปลกที่จะเกิดปัญหานี้
ข้อแนะนำคือเปลี่ยนมาใช้ตัว "" หรือ ; หรือ , หรือ Tab แทนการใช้ตัว | จะดีกว่า